Our analysis found Delaware Technical Community College - Terry to be the best school for teaching students who want to pursue a basic certificate in Delaware.

The average in-state tuition and fees for students at Delaware Tech is $4,945. Out-of-state students pay an average of $11,808.

Delaware Tech does have options available for those who want to take online classes. You will need to check with the school to see if they are available for your specific major. Of all the undergraduates enrolled at the school during the 2019-2020 academic year, around 93% took at least some of their classes online.

Delaware State University

Dover, Delaware
$8,358 Average Tuition & Fees

Out of the 2 schools in Delaware that were part of this year’s ranking, Delaware State University landed the # 2 spot on the list.

In-state students pay an average of $8,358 in tuition and fees if they attend Del State full time. Out-of-state students pay an average of $18,280.

If you are interested in distance education, be sure to check with the school since Del State does offer online classes for certain majors. In 2019-2020 about 66% of the undergraduate students at the school chose to take one or more online courses.
